Maxar Technologies and NASA have completed the critical design review phase of a mission intended to demonstrate robotic satellite refueling and in-space manufacturing and assembly. The space agency said Friday its On-orbit Servicing, Assembly and Manufacturing 1 or OSAM-1 achieved mission CDR completion in February, less than a year following the CDR milestone for the […] More

Maxar Technologies has booked over $100 million in three agreements that extend the company’s work of delivering satellite imagery to international defense and intelligence customers. The company said Wednesday its Direct Access Program will continue to enable the unnamed clients to download 30 cm-class data from Maxar’s constellation of Earth imaging satellites to their ground […] More
The Defense Innovation Unit has awarded Maxar Technologies a $9.3 million contract to further develop and deliver to the agency a pair of robotic arms for in-space assembly activities. Maxar said Monday it will test and provide its approximately six-foot-long robotic arms within a three-year timeline. The arms will run on a single motor with […] More
Maxar Technologies is planning to hold a launch between May 15 and June 13 for the first two of its six WorldView Legion imaging satellites onboard a SpaceX rocket. The upcoming WorldView Legion satellite constellation is meant to provide geospatial intelligence with a 30 cm-class resolution in both polar and mid-inclination orbits, the Westminster, Colorado-based […] More
Maxar Technologies‘ Space Program Delivery team has integrated NASA’s Tropospheric Emissions: Monitoring of Pollution payload with its host spacecraft to monitor and track air pollution in North America. The TEMPO payload, built by Ball Aerospace and in collaboration with NASA and the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, is hosted on the Intelsat 40e geostationary communications satellite and will […] More

Maxar Technologies has received a $60 million contract to help the National Geospatial-Intelligence Agency operate a classified national security platform for analyzing large amounts of data. The company said Monday it will continue to support analytics technology for the intelligence community and defense agencies under the five-year contract. “Our work now focuses on improving access […] More
